What is the law of conservation of mass?
No
atoms
are
lost
or
made
during a
chemical reaction
.

How does the law of conservation of mass apply to chemical reactions?
The mass of the
products
equals the mass of the
reactants
.

If 24 grams of magnesium reacts with 71 grams of chlorine, what is the mass of magnesium chloride produced?
95 grams

If 92 grams of sodium reacts with 32 grams of oxygen, what is the mass of sodium oxide produced?
124
grams

How do you calculate the mass of calcium carbonate that reacted if it produced 112 grams of calcium oxide and 88 grams of carbon dioxide?
The mass of calcium carbonate is
200
grams.

If magnesium oxide reacts with 73 grams of hydrogen chloride to produce 95 grams of magnesium chloride and 18 grams of water, what is the mass of magnesium oxide?
40
grams

What are the steps to calculate the mass of products in a chemical reaction?
Identify the
reactants
and their
masses
.
Add the masses of the reactants to find the total mass.
Use the
law of conservation of mass
to determine the mass of products.
